About 15 Aintree Avenue
15 Aintree Avenue is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Hereford (HR4 9NQ). It has a recorded floor area of 72 m² (around 775 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(February 2015) shows a C (score 70). The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since June 2013.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Average to Very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88). The latest certificate is from February 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Other recorded features include a conservatory.
At 72 m² the property is well over the postcode median (55 m² across 10 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Across 2013–2017, sale prices on this property compounded at 4%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£223,000 is 42% above the 2017 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£203/sq ft) was about 28% above the typical sold price in the postcode. On the market in November 2017 and unlisted since — roughly 9 years.
